Biography / Trivia

A prominent artist of the Ninja Tune label, Amon Tobin mixes and distort electronic, jazz, drum and bass, trip-hop, ambient and even more genres into a multi-layered unique result. He was born Amon Adonai Santos de Araujo Tobin in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, and later went to live in the UK, where his musical career. His first album, "Adventures in Foam" was released under the name Cujo. In 1996, he joined the Ninja Tune label and has released four albums since then: "Bricolage" (1997), "Permutation" (1998), "Supermodified" (2000) and "Out From Out Where" (2002). He moved to Montréal, Canada, in 2002, where he finished "Out From Out Where" and still curently resides. His first and only video game soundtrack so far was composed in 2005, for the Ubisoft Montréal game "Splinter Cell: Chaos Theory".
